The role can be worked remotely and will be reporting to the Senior Risk and Compliance Manager. The main purpose of the role is to support the Risk & Compliance team in an administrative capacity. Some key objectives & responsibilities will include:
- Monthly and quarterly reporting and analysis of firms’ compliance performance to identify risks and issues.
- Assisting with creating presentation of outcomes for firms and committees.
- Managing FCA Connect applications including SMF applications, annual attestations and firm changes.
- Assisting with data collation and input for periodic regulatory reporting including RMAR, REP019, REP021, REP025, CCR009 and CMA PNCD.
- Ensuring all ICO registration is up to date and accurate.
- Monitoring R&C ticketing system for incoming emails and allocation of tasks to the R&C team.
- Following the Group procedures for requests for new Introducers, including undertaking due diligence, completing and submitting applications, reviewing and issuing contracts, registering with FCA where IAR status is required.
- Reviewing and approving financial promotions and liaising with the Marketing team.
- Reviewing Sanction referrals submitted to R&C in accordance with the Group sanction checking procedure.
- Collating news articles and other publications for regulatory horizon scanning.
- Collaborate with Group Agency to review compliance provisions within insurer contracts, ensuring alignment with regulatory requirements and Jensten standards.
- Maintain Risk & Compliance content on the Group intranet, including updating and administering reporting forms (breaches, complaints, gifts & hospitality, and conflicts of interest), monitoring incoming submissions, and uploading approved Risk & Compliance policies.
- Other ad-hoc support for the R&C team as required.

Jensten is one of the UK’s leading insurance intermediary groups, known for putting clients and people first. Since launching in 2018, we’ve built a standout business in a crowded marketplace — combining scale, deep technical expertise and entrepreneurial spirit. Operating through six specialist divisions — Network Broking, Regional Broking, Schemes Broking, Specialist Lines, London Market Broking and Underwriting — we deliver tailored insurance solutions directly to clients and through a network of trusted third party broking partners. Thanks to strong organic growth and a strategic acquisition programme, Jensten is now a Top 10 Independent Broker, placing more than £650 million GWP into the market. We employ around 1,000 colleagues across 35 locations and support 85 entrepreneurial franchise holders nationwide.
